public class WebUtils extends Object
| 构造器和说明 |
|---|
WebUtils() |
| 限定符和类型 | 方法和说明 |
|---|---|
static String |
getBaseUrl(javax.servlet.http.HttpServletRequest request) |
static String |
getBaseUrl(javax.servlet.http.HttpServletRequest request,
boolean withContextPath)
获取baseurl
nginx转发需设置 proxy_set_header X-Forwarded-Proto $scheme; |
static String |
getBaseUrl(String url) |
static String |
getDomain(String url) |
static String |
getOriginDomain(javax.servlet.http.HttpServletRequest request) |
static String |
getRootDomain(javax.servlet.http.HttpServletRequest request)
获取根域名
|
static String |
getRootDomain(String url) |
static boolean |
isInternalRequest(javax.servlet.http.HttpServletRequest request)
是否内网调用
|
static boolean |
isJsonRequest(javax.servlet.http.HttpServletRequest request) |
static boolean |
isMultipartContent(javax.servlet.http.HttpServletRequest request) |
static void |
printRequest(javax.servlet.http.HttpServletRequest request) |
static void |
responseOutHtml(javax.servlet.http.HttpServletResponse response,
String html) |
static void |
responseOutJson(javax.servlet.http.HttpServletResponse response,
String json) |
static void |
responseOutJsonp(javax.servlet.http.HttpServletResponse response,
String callbackFunName,
Object jsonObject) |
static void |
whoReport() |
public static boolean isJsonRequest(javax.servlet.http.HttpServletRequest request)
public static void responseOutJson(javax.servlet.http.HttpServletResponse response,
String json)
public static void responseOutHtml(javax.servlet.http.HttpServletResponse response,
String html)
public static void responseOutJsonp(javax.servlet.http.HttpServletResponse response,
String callbackFunName,
Object jsonObject)
public static String getRootDomain(javax.servlet.http.HttpServletRequest request)
request - public static String getOriginDomain(javax.servlet.http.HttpServletRequest request)
public static String getBaseUrl(javax.servlet.http.HttpServletRequest request)
public static String getBaseUrl(javax.servlet.http.HttpServletRequest request, boolean withContextPath)
request - withContextPath - public static final boolean isMultipartContent(javax.servlet.http.HttpServletRequest request)
public static boolean isInternalRequest(javax.servlet.http.HttpServletRequest request)
request - public static void whoReport()
public static void printRequest(javax.servlet.http.HttpServletRequest request)
Copyright © 2025. All rights reserved.